Combine the protein brownie mix and water in a mug and whisk together until completely mixed and no lumps remain. Optional: add a few mini chocolate chips on top.
Microwave for about 1 minute, or until the brownie rises and the top of the brownie is no longer raw or wet. KEEP AN EYE ON THE BROWNIE IN THE MICROWAVE to make sure it does not overflow. Do not overcook.
Let cool for a minute. Sprinkle with powdered sugar on top if you like, and dig in with a fork or spoon!
Notes
→ Wash and dry the plastic scoop thoroughly before placing back into the brownie mix container. → Use a mug that is at least 6 oz to make sure the brownie batter doesn't overflow as it expands. 8 oz is better. You can also use a microwave-safe bowl or ramekin that is 6+ oz. DO NOT TAKE YOUR EYES OFF THE MICROWAVE if you're using a small mug. If you see the brownie starting to overflow, just open the microwave door, wait a few seconds for it to deflate a little, then continue microwaving. → Microwave strengths vary. My microwave is 1000 watts, I use the high power setting, and the brownie is consistently perfectly baked after 1 minute. Your brownie might be done as early as ~45-50 seconds or might take as long as 1:30. Do NOT overcook it or it will be dry and crumbly. → Any chocolate chips you add at the beginning will mostly sink during cooking. If you want some chocolate chips on top, just pause the microwave at 30 seconds, add a few chips on top, then continue microwaving.
